How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North Creek Snohomish?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
North Creek Snohomish Studio Apartments | $1,840 | $1,365 | $2,265 |
North Creek Snohomish 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,047 | $1,455 | $4,218 |
North Creek Snohomish 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,384 | $1,575 | $6,541 |
North Creek Snohomish 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,656 | $2,175 | $8,957 |
North Creek Snohomish 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,445 | $2,444 | $2,453 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
